fc547e08 | 232 | /**\r |
233 | Sets the SKU value for subsequent calls to set or get PCD token values.\r | |
234 | \r | |
235 | SetSku() sets the SKU Id to be used for subsequent calls to set or get PCD values. \r | |
236 | SetSku() is normally called only once by the system.\r | |
237 | \r | |
238 | For each item (token), the database can hold a single value that applies to all SKUs, \r | |
239 | or multiple values, where each value is associated with a specific SKU Id. Items with multiple, \r | |
240 | SKU-specific values are called SKU enabled. \r | |
241 | \r | |
120ca3ce | 242 | The SKU Id of zero is reserved as a default.\r |
fc547e08 | 243 | For tokens that are not SKU enabled, the system ignores any set SKU Id and works with the \r |
244 | single value for that token. For SKU-enabled tokens, the system will use the SKU Id set by the \r | |
245 | last call to SetSku(). If no SKU Id is set or the currently set SKU Id isn't valid for the specified token, \r | |
246 | the system uses the default SKU Id. If the system attempts to use the default SKU Id and no value has been \r | |
247 | set for that Id, the results are unpredictable.\r | |

fc547e08 | 1027 | /**\r |
90e06556 | 1028 | Retrieves the next valid token number in a given namespace. \r |
1029 | \r | |
1030 | This is useful since the PCD infrastructure contains a sparse list of token numbers, \r | |
1031 | and one cannot a priori know what token numbers are valid in the database. \r | |
1032 | \r | |
1033 | If TokenNumber is 0 and Guid is not NULL, then the first token from the token space specified by Guid is returned. \r | |
1034 | If TokenNumber is not 0 and Guid is not NULL, then the next token in the token space specified by Guid is returned. \r | |
1035 | If TokenNumber is 0 and Guid is NULL, then the first token in the default token space is returned. \r | |
1036 | If TokenNumber is not 0 and Guid is NULL, then the next token in the default token space is returned. \r | |
1037 | The token numbers in the default token space may not be related to token numbers in token spaces that are named by Guid. \r | |
1038 | If the next token number can be retrieved, then it is returned in TokenNumber, and EFI_SUCCESS is returned. \r | |
1039 | If TokenNumber represents the last token number in the token space specified by Guid, then EFI_NOT_FOUND is returned. \r | |
1040 | If TokenNumber is not present in the token space specified by Guid, then EFI_NOT_FOUND is returned.\r | |
